Position Summary

Family Behavior Solutions is seeking a compassionate and dependable Paraprofessional to provide direct support services to children diagnosed with Autism and related disabilities. Working under the guidance of clinical supervisors, this role involves implementing individualized treatment plans using the principles of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) in various settings including home, school, clinic, and community environments. The ideal candidate is patient, engaged, and dedicated to supporting each child’s growth through structured and nurturing intervention.

Essential

Duties and Responsibilities

The essential functions include, but are not limited to the following: Provide 1:1 ABA-based support services in the home setting Implement the client’s individualized Treatment Plan as directed by the Clinical Team Run sessions using Discrete Trial Training (DTT), Natural Environment Teaching (NET), work in small groups in areas of social skills, and assist with Activities of Daily Living Skills (ADLS) Consistently collect and document accurate data using electronic clinical software to support client progress Collaborate with a multidisciplinary treatment team and receive regular, supportive feedback to enhance service delivery Model appropriate social, communication, and play skills during all ABA sessions Communicate clearly and professionally with families, caregivers, and clinical staff Maintain a consistent session schedule and report progress or concerns promptly Attend and actively participate in all staff and site-specific trainings Adhere to safety protocols and ethical standards of ABA service delivery Maintain client confidentiality in accordance with HIPAA and company policy

Physical Demands and Work Environment

This position requires frequent movement, including standing, walking, kneeling, playing on the floor, and light lifting (up to 30 lbs) while engaging with children in home and community settings. Paraprofessionals must be able to respond quickly and physically to ensure the safety of clients, including potential physical intervention in behavioral situations. Reliable transportation is required for travel between multiple service locations. The work may take place in varied environments, including homes, clinics, schools, or outdoor settings, and may involve occasional exposure to loud noises or physically active behavior from clients.

Requirements

Minimum Qualifications (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ities): High school diploma or equivalent required; associate or bachelor's degree in psychology, education, or related field preferred Must be at least 19 years old Previous experience working with children, especially those with developmental or behavioral needs, is strongly preferred Basic understanding of ABA principles, with a willingness to receive ongoing training and supervision Strong communication and interpersonal skills with the ability to build rapport with children and families Reliable transportation and willingness to travel between client locations within the service area Must pass background check and meet all state and company-specific employment requirements Ability to follow directions, adhere to structured plans, and document data accurately
